Step-by-Step Instructions
- Trim any excess fat from the chicken breasts and slice into smaller cutlets, about 1-inch thick. Pat dry with paper towels.
- In a zip-top bag, combine potato flakes, arrowroot or potato starch, salt, pepper, paprika, garlic powder, and onion powder. Seal and crush flakes for even mixing.
- Coat chicken cutlets in the potato mixture inside the bag, then dip in whisked eggs, letting excess drip off, and return to the bag for a second coating.
- Heat enough oil in a skillet over medium heat to cover the bottom, about 1/4 inch deep. Preheat until shimmering, about 3-4 minutes.
- Fry chicken cutlets in the hot oil for about 5 minutes per side, or until golden brown and internal temperature reaches 165°F. Transfer to paper towel-lined plates.
- For air frying, preheat air fryer to 350°F, place cutlets in a single layer, cook for 6 minutes on one side, then flip and cook for another 6 minutes.
- In a cold pot, combine coconut milk with additional arrowroot or potato starch. Turn heat to medium, whisk continuously until the gravy thickens, about 4-5 minutes.
- Serve chicken and gravy with Whole30 Mashed Potatoes or steamed veggies.

Notes
Ensure chicken cutlets are dry before breading for crispiness. Monitor oil temperature to avoid sogginess. Fresh spices enhance flavor.
